How to Monetize Minecraft Servers, Maps, and Mods

 Monetizing Minecraft servers, maps, and mods is one of the smartest ways to turn your passion into income — if you do it right. The first step is choosing the right platform. Most successful monetization happens on Minecraft Java Edition , where servers, plugins, and mods have the biggest audience and flexibility. For servers , common revenue methods include paid ranks, cosmetic items, battle passes, and VIP perks. Focus on cosmetics and convenience, not pay-to-win features, to keep your community loyal and compliant with Minecraft’s EULA. A smooth server experience and active moderation matter more than flashy perks. When it comes to maps , creators earn through marketplaces, Patreon, or direct downloads. Adventure maps, survival challenges, and PvP arenas sell best when they’re well-tested and frequently updated. Clear instructions and regular support build trust with players. How to use trusted sites to get Spotify Premium — the safe way

  How to use trusted sites to get Spotify Premium — the safe way Want Premium without falling for scams? Use only trusted, official channels . Here’s how: Start at Spotify or official app stores Always sign up or redeem offers through spotify.com , the Spotify app, Apple App Store, or Google Play Store. Those are the only places to trust for trials and subscriptions. Check partner promotions (legit partners only) Mobile carriers, device makers, and streaming bundles sometimes include months of Premium. If a carrier or retailer advertises an offer, confirm it on their official website (not a random landing page). Use verified gift cards & vouchers Buy Spotify gift cards from reputable retailers (Amazon, major supermarkets, official stores) and redeem them in your Spotify account settings.
